1. Classification of Aluminium Grades
Aluminium grades can be broadly classified into two categories: non-heat-treatable and heat-treatable. Additionally, they are often categorized based on their primary alloying elements, such as copper, magnesium, silicon, manganese, and zinc.
Non-Heat-Treatable Grades
These grades cannot be strengthened significantly through heat treatment processes like annealing or quenching. They derive their strength primarily from cold working or the addition of alloying elements. Common non-heat-treatable grades include:
1000 Series: Pure aluminium with a minimum of 99% aluminium content. Known for excellent electrical and thermal conductivity, formability, and corrosion resistance. Common alloys include 1050, 1060, and 1100.
3000 Series: Aluminium-manganese alloys, known for good formability, corrosion resistance, and moderate strength.
5000 Series: Aluminium-magnesium alloys, offering good corrosion resistance, weldability, and moderate strength. Widely used in marine and architectural applications.
Heat-Treatable Grades
These grades can be significantly strengthened through heat treatment processes like solution heat treatment and aging. Common heat-treatable grades include:
2000 Series: Aluminium-copper alloys, known for high strength and good machinability. However, they are less corrosion-resistant than other grades.
6000 Series: Aluminium-magnesium-silicon alloys, offering a good balance of strength, corrosion resistance, and formability. Widely used in automotive and aerospace applications.
7000 Series: Aluminium-zinc alloys, renowned for their exceptional strength-to-weight ratio. They are used in high-performance applications requiring maximum strength.
